ETOWAH COUNTY – Acton Bowen, a youth evangelist, has entered a plea of not guilty by reason of mental disorder or defect in regards to several child sex charges, according to Carol Robinson of Al.com.
In June Bowen was indicted by a grand jury for the charges of second-degree sodomy, enticing a child into a vehicle or home for the purpose of a sex act, traveling to meet a child for an unlawful sex act, facilitating, arranging, providing or paying for the transport of a child for the purpose of a sex act, and second-degree sexual abuse.
Bowen is currently being held in the Etowah County Jail. He is without bond.
